This iconic Canadian artist captured the spirit of the West Coast like no other, painting towering forests, vibrant Indigenous villages, and the raw beauty of the Pacific Northwest.

Introducing your children to Emily Carr's art is more than just an art lesson; it's a window into a pivotal time in Canadian history and a celebration of individuality. Her bold brushstrokes and expressive use of colour resonate even with young eyes, making her work surprisingly accessible and engaging. By exploring her paintings of totem poles, majestic trees, and the powerful ocean, children can learn about Indigenous cultures, the importance of conservation, and the courage it takes to forge your own artistic path.
